One report earlier this yr by the Tel Aviv Center for Ukrainian Refugees famous that between March and August 2022, there have been three different rape circumstances involving Ukrainian refugees reported to the police. There had been also 18 circumstances of sexual harassment underneath police investigation and 12 other cases of sexual harassment reported to volunteers but not filed with the police, famous the report. When Svetlana followed up with the help of former MK Ibtisam Mara’ana as to why, the police stated she was welcome to enchantment the choice by providing additional evidence. By then, Svetlana, severely traumatized, mentioned she had no power to continue with the investigation.

Access to livelihood opportunities and primary companies, including life-saving sexual and reproductive well being care and knowledge, has been severely disrupted. Gender-based violence can be pervasive, however instances proceed to be under-reported. A lack of entry to social and childcare companies and strained group sources make both internally displaced and native girls largely responsible for the care for youngsters, disabled and aged members of the family, and made it harder for them to search out employment. According to Sielewicz, nearly all of the women that are entering Poland via Ukraine proper now are women with superior degrees—doctors, business ladies, and others—who have youngsters.

Civil Network OPORA, that are documenting situations of trafficking, human rights violations, and warfare crimes towards civilians. Since the beginning of the invasion, La Strada’s hotline has had five instances as many calls for help.

Teenagers, separated from their households and socially isolated, are a perfect target. A 14-year-old Ukrainian woman in Warsaw disappeared with a 36-year-old Syrian man. Of the 134,000 Ukrainian refugees formally recorded as getting into Spain because the battle started, more than a third are beneath eighteen.

A volunteer on the Tesco informed me that within the early days of the war, before personal drivers needed to register their automobiles with the police, one mom and her baby accepted a ride, just for the mom to be pushed out halfway by way of the journey. Every reception centre has stories like this from the war’s chaotic early phase. Measures such as the wristband system on the Tesco and checkpoints at exits are becoming more widespread, however they are not persistently utilized. The warfare in Ukraine has led to greater than four.2 million refugees and over 7 million internally displaced individuals, most of them girls and children. The war contributed to growing dangers, including trafficking, gender-based violence, sexual exploitation and abuse, and compelled labor.

So she requested her brother Andrii and his girlfriend Kseniia Drahanyuk to ship her the objects she needed -- and after the two realized simply how much gear Kolesnyk was lacking, they created the Zemlyachki nonprofit to assist different female soldiers. They've now helped over three,000 ladies, sending them over $1 million value of care packages that embrace things like lighter body armor, tampons, smaller footwear, and fitted uniforms, Kolesnyk mentioned.
